What was growing up in Australia like? 

I think the major difference would be that life in Australia is very outdoorsy. We spend a lot of time playing sports, swimming, and playing in parks. There’s a lot of physical activity growing up and, of course, the beach is such a huge part of life. Lots of greenery and sunshine help cultivate a really chill vibe. Aussies work to live, so once it is 5 pm, the workday is done and they fire up the BBQ!

What was your first job?

I’ve had so many jobs, like McDonald’s to cafés and clothing stores. But my first job was selling candy door-to-door for charity. I made 50 cents from every bag I sold.
